According to the public record, Beech Pines, Stoke-On-Trent is a modern house with 3,639 ft2 of internal area and sits on a 9,840 m2 plot.
Houses of this size in this area normally have 5 bedrooms with a garden.
Based on available information, and assuming reasonable condition, the estimated sale value for Beech Pines, Stoke-On-Trent is £866,286 and the estimated rental value is £2,766 per month.

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If Beech Pines, Stoke-On-Trent is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£909,600 and a rental value of £2,905 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£805,646 and a rental value of £2,573 per month.
Over the last 12 months the sale value of Beech Pines Stoke-On-Trent has increased by an estimated £14,107 (1.6%) and its rental value has increased by an estimated £32 per month (1.2%), giving an expected gross yield of 3.8%.
According to data from HM Land Registry, Beech Pines, Stoke-On-Trent sits on a plot of 9840m2.
We have plot size data on 10 out of 16 other houses in the postcode and Beech Pines, Stoke-On-Trent sits on the 4th largest plot.
Beech Pines, Stoke-On-Trent has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of B.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 18 Oct 2011.
The property is not connected to mains gas and has fully double glazed windows. It is heated using Ground source heat pump, underfloor, electric.
